Shuswap language
The Shuswap language (; Shuswap: Secwepemctsín ) is the traditional language of the Shuswap people (Shuswap: Secwépemc ) of British Columbia. An endangered language, Shuswap is spoken mainly in the Central and Southern Interior of British Columbia between the Fraser River and the Rocky Mountains. According to the First Peoples' Cultural Council, 200 people speak Shuswap as a mother tongue, and there are 1,190 semi-speakers.
